PM Modi Wishes People "Spring Of Happiness" On Holi

On the occasion of Holi, Prime Minister Narendra Modi conveyed his heartfelt greetings to the nation, wishing everyone a 'spring of happiness.' In his message, Modi emphasized the significance of the festival, which celebrates the arrival of spring and the triumph of good over evil. Holi, known for its vibrant colors and joyous celebrations, unites people across diverse backgrounds, fostering harmony and goodwill. The Prime Minister called upon citizens to embrace the spirit of Holi by spreading love and positivity in their communities. As India prepares to celebrate this joyful occasion, Modi's message resonates with the ethos of togetherness and joy that Holi embodies, encouraging all to partake in the festivities with enthusiasm and cheer.
